Producer

Golan Heights Winery

Golan Heights Winery captures the essence of an ancient terroir, producing exquisite wines that harmonize elegance and boldness. Characterized by vibrant acidity and deep fruit flavors, these wines often showcase lush notes of blackberry, spice, and herbal undertones. Renowned for their Cabernet Sauvignon and Chardonnay, they embody meticulous craftsmanship and a commitment to innovation. The winery’s dedication to sustainability reflects its rich heritage, making each bottle a testament to a unique, evolving landscape.

Grape

Shiraz/Syrah

Shiraz, known as Syrah in France, produces bold, full-bodied wines with rich flavors of dark fruits, black pepper, and chocolate. These wines often exhibit aromas of blackberry, plum, and licorice, with peppery and smoky notes. Common styles include fruity, refreshing rosés and complex, oak-aged reds. Notable regions include the Rhône Valley (France), Barossa Valley (Australia), and Stellenbosch (South Africa). Interestingly, Shiraz is the same grape as Syrah, differing primarily in climate and winemaking approach.
